A conveyor belt is moving at a constant speed of 2m/s. A box is gently dropped on it. The coefficient of friction between them is µ= 0.5. The distance that the box will move relative to belt before coming to rest on it taking g = 10 ms -2 , is:

A
1.2 m
B
0.6 m
C
zero
D
0.4 m
